VERDICT: The Jamie Snowden stable can do little wrong at present and the impressive point-to-point winner Colonel Harry is taken to strike on his Rules debut. The five-year-old is related to plenty of winners and he gets the vote ahead of Seigneur Des As, who brings a decent level of form from France. Knockanore showed up well on both of his outings in the spring and he cannot be ruled out either.
